From 70bb7240d0299b5a6a1485c24df6d4617449abd3 Mon Sep 17 00:00:00 2001 From: Andrei Kvapil Date: Fri, 9 Feb 2024 13:24:33 +0100 Subject: [PATCH] Fix: tenant-root domain always overrided to example.org (#10) Signed-off-by: Andrei Kvapil --- packages/core/platform/Makefile | 12 +++++++----- packages/core/platform/templates/apps.yaml | 2 +- 2 files changed, 8 insertions(+), 6 deletions(-) diff --git a/packages/core/platform/Makefile b/packages/core/platform/Makefile index e38a0947..74668225 100644 --- a/packages/core/platform/Makefile +++ b/packages/core/platform/Makefile @@ -1,17 +1,19 @@ NAMESPACE=cozy-system NAME=platform +API_VERSIONS_FLAGS=$(addprefix -a ,$(shell kubectl api-versions)) + show: - helm template -n $(NAMESPACE) $(NAME) . --dry-run=server + helm template -n $(NAMESPACE) $(NAME) . --dry-run=server $(API_VERSIONS_FLAGS) apply: - helm template -n $(NAMESPACE) $(NAME) . --dry-run=server | kubectl apply -f- + helm template -n $(NAMESPACE) $(NAME) . --dry-run=server $(API_VERSIONS_FLAGS) | kubectl apply -f- namespaces-show: - helm template -n $(NAMESPACE) $(NAME) . --dry-run=server -s templates/namespaces.yaml + helm template -n $(NAMESPACE) $(NAME) . --dry-run=server $(API_VERSIONS_FLAGS) -s templates/namespaces.yaml namespaces-apply: - helm template -n $(NAMESPACE) $(NAME) . --dry-run=server -s templates/namespaces.yaml | kubectl apply -f- + helm template -n $(NAMESPACE) $(NAME) . --dry-run=server $(API_VERSIONS_FLAGS) -s templates/namespaces.yaml | kubectl apply -f- diff: - helm template -n $(NAMESPACE) $(NAME) . --dry-run=server -s templates/namespaces.yaml | kubectl diff -f- + helm template -n $(NAMESPACE) $(NAME) . --dry-run=server $(API_VERSIONS_FLAGS) -s templates/namespaces.yaml | kubectl diff -f- diff --git a/packages/core/platform/templates/apps.yaml b/packages/core/platform/templates/apps.yaml index 74439ff2..6f3091f3 100644 --- a/packages/core/platform/templates/apps.yaml +++ b/packages/core/platform/templates/apps.yaml @@ -1,7 +1,7 @@ {{- $host := "example.org" }} {{- $tenantRoot := list }} {{- if .Capabilities.APIVersions.Has "helm.toolkit.fluxcd.io/v2beta1" }} -{{- $tenantRoot := lookup "helm.toolkit.fluxcd.io/v2beta1" "HelmRelease" "tenant-root" "tenant-root" }} +{{- $tenantRoot = lookup "helm.toolkit.fluxcd.io/v2beta1" "HelmRelease" "tenant-root" "tenant-root" }} {{- end }} {{- if and $tenantRoot $tenantRoot.spec $tenantRoot.spec.values $tenantRoot.spec.values.host }} {{- $host = $tenantRoot.spec.values.host }}